I got 6 hp to the wheels with the pullies on my SE-R. It is documented on
se-r.net and my SCC article.
On project Sweet 16 we got 2 hp to the wheels, but it felt better than that.
The engine reved freer. 2 solid hp accross the power band is pretty
decent for a cheap mod like a pulley. I would do the cat back, header, ecu,
and CAI first through.
